Output 05cbaf80128599054fe8cf2b5592b3ba092c5f5af21c8dc4ee16b7cf60bec1c5:26

value
35287176
script pubkey
OP_0 OP_PUSHBYTES_20 13c61a8eb49d42fba411b3fff043723a3acd61ee
address
ltc1qz0rp4r45n4p0hfq3k0llqsmj8gav6c0wgpmd2e
transaction
05cbaf80128599054fe8cf2b5592b3ba092c5f5af21c8dc4ee16b7cf60bec1c5
spent
true